Restaurant delivery food robots, as the most widely used type of service robots in the catering industry, have effectively solved the pain points of labor shortage, high labor cost and uneven service quality in the catering field. Different from the traditional manual delivery mode, these robots are equipped with advanced laser navigation, visual recognition and obstacle avoidance systems, which can accurately plan the optimal delivery route in complex restaurant environments, bypass diners, tables and other obstacles flexibly, and deliver meals to the designated table quickly and safely. Whether it is a bustling hot pot restaurant, a elegant western restaurant or a crowded food court, restaurant delivery food robots can adapt to different scenarios with high efficiency. They can work 24 hours a day without rest, fatigue or emotional fluctuations, ensuring stable and consistent service quality. At the same time, the application of delivery robots also reduces the contact between service staff and diners, which is more in line with the health and safety needs of public catering scenes, especially in the post-epidemic era, it has become an important measure for catering enterprises to improve health management level.
On the basis of restaurant delivery functions, intelligent tray return food delivery robots have further extended the service chain of catering robots, realizing the dual functions of "delivery and recovery", which is a more intelligent and comprehensive solution for the catering industry. After diners finish their meals, they only need to place the used tableware and trays in the designated area of the robot, and the intelligent tray return robot can automatically recognize, collect and transport the tableware to the kitchen or cleaning area. This not only reduces the workload of waiters, who no longer need to shuttle back and forth between tables and kitchens to collect tableware, but also speeds up the table turning efficiency of restaurants. For diners, it simplifies the process of returning tableware, improves the dining experience; for catering enterprises, it optimizes the service process, reduces labor costs and improves operational efficiency. The intelligent tray return food delivery robot is equipped with a high-precision weight sensor and visual recognition system, which can accurately identify different types of tableware, avoid overflow of residual soup and food, and ensure the cleanliness and hygiene of the transportation process. Some high-end models can also classify and place tableware according to preset programs, laying a foundation for the subsequent automatic cleaning of tableware.
In addition to the catering industry, hotel robots have also become a new symbol of intelligent hotels, injecting new vitality into the hotel service industry. Hotel robots cover a variety of service scenarios, including guest room delivery, front desk guidance, floor patrol, luggage transportation and other functions, fully meeting the diversified needs of hotel operation and guest stay. When guests need to send mineral water, towels, snacks and other items to the room, they only need to place an order through the hotel app or the phone in the room, and the hotel delivery robot can take the items and navigate to the designated room accurately, and complete the delivery through the intelligent door opening system, without the need for guests to go out or wait for the service staff. For the hotel, this not only saves the labor cost of room service, but also improves the response speed of service, realizing "24-hour on-call" intimate service. In addition, hotel robots can also act as "intelligent guides", providing guests with information such as hotel facilities introduction, surrounding scenic spots recommendation and catering reservation; as floor patrol robots, they can monitor the safety of public areas in real time, detect potential safety hazards such as fire and water leakage, and ensure the safety of hotel operation. Of course, the development of service robots is still in a stage of continuous progress and improvement. At present, some robots still have certain limitations in complex environments, such as difficulty in adapting to extremely crowded scenes or sudden obstacles; the interaction between robots and humans still needs to be more natural and intelligent; the maintenance and operation cost of robots is also a problem that enterprises need to consider. However, with the continuous investment of scientific and technological research and development and the continuous accumulation of application experience, these problems will be gradually solved.
